If you spend a summertime in Phoenix az, you find out rapidly that a/c is not a luxury. It belongs to the home's vital facilities, like a roofing and a hot water heater rolled into one. When something breaks, the question we listen to most from home owners is simple and immediate. What is this mosting likely to cost me, and where does the huge cash enter a HVAC system? After two decades of summer callouts, roof saves, and late night system swaps, our answer has actually come to be clear. In Phoenix az, the solitary most expensive part inside a residential air conditioning or heatpump is the compressor. However that is just half of the tale. The method homes are developed here, and the way equipment is installed on roofs, can make the "most costly part" either the compressor or the entire exterior system, specifically for packaged rooftop systems.

Phoenix warm changes the calculus

The Valley's environment penalizes devices. We ask heating and cooling systems to bring 110 to 118 levels of afternoon heat for months, after that take a breath via dirt from haboobs and gale microbursts. Roofing system temperature levels can run 20 to 40 levels hotter than the air, so an outdoor unit could be dropping heat into air that feels like it comes from a stove. That warmth load presses compressors to the side. Any kind of weak point, from a minimal capacitor to a small cooling agent leak, ends up being a significant failing at 4 p.m. In July. This is why heating and cooling repair service calls spike by an aspect of four between May and August for each cooling and heating company in the region, and why one of the most expensive component often tends to be the one doing the most ruthless work.

The compressor, and why it tops the rate chart

Think of the compressor as the air conditioning's heart. It pressurizes cooling agent and relocates heat from your home to the outdoors. In older, single stage systems, the compressor is an uncomplicated motor with a piston or scroll set. In more recent, high performance systems, you see two stage or inverter driven compressors that regulate rate and pressure. Those advanced compressors pull power a lot more beautifully and run quieter, however they are a lot more complicated and expensive.

When a compressor stops working in Phoenix, parts alone can run 1,500 to 3,500 bucks for common solitary phase models, and 3,000 to 5,500 bucks for inverter compressors connected to proprietary control panel. Include labor, refrigerant, and recuperation or discharge work, and the installed rate to replace a negative compressor typically lands in the 2,800 to 7,500 dollar variety. The range relies on the brand, refrigerant type, guarantee standing, and whether your unit is a split system on the side of your house or a rooftop package needing crane time.

This is why, when you ask one of the most costly line on a repair work ticket for a significant failure, the solution is the compressor more often than not. It is the cost of the part, the trouble of the job, and the threat entailed. On a 115 degree day, drawing a compressor out of a roof cupboard and brazing in a new one, then drawing a deep vacuum cleaner and charging specifically, is one of one of the most demanding jobs in a/c repair.

When the "most expensive component" comes to be the whole exterior unit

In Phoenix az, there is a twist. Several homes and small business rooms make use of packaged rooftop devices, particularly in older neighborhoods and strip centers. A packaged system includes the compressor, condenser coil, blower, and manages in a solitary cabinet. If the compressor fails and the unit is out of warranty, home owners typically select to replace the entire package as opposed to the compressor alone. Factors include the age of the warm exchanger, UV damages to circuitry and insulation, and effectiveness upgrades that bring genuine savings.

A roof changeout adds costs you do not see on a ground degree split system. There is crane time to lift the system, website traffic control if the street need to be partially closed, a curb adapter to fit the brand-new cabinet to the old roofing curb, and commonly duct transitions or electric upgrades to satisfy code. Those items can add 1,200 to 3,500 dollars to a task that otherwise could be an uncomplicated like for like swap on a slab. Therefore, one of the most pricey "component" on the proposal sheet ends up being the outdoor unit itself, not simply the compressor inside it. Totally mounted roof packages typically vary from 9,000 to 18,000 bucks for typical capabilities, and extra for big homes or high effectiveness variable speed models.

Why compressors fall short more frequently here

We track failing creates across our cooling and heating solutions in Phoenix az. Year after year, the exact same perpetrators show up.

Heat saturation. Compressors run hotter under high ambient conditions. Oil breaks down much faster, electrical windings see more tension, and thermal overloads trip extra conveniently. A little limitation in the metering gadget that would be a problem in San Diego can melt a winding in Phoenix.

Voltage fluctuations. Brownouts and short period voltage dips, especially in older neighborhoods during height tons, can press a compressor right into a stalled or locked rotor condition. That gets too hot windings. We suggest difficult beginning packages only when needed and sized correctly. The wrong set can create a bigger trouble than it solves.

Dust and airflow restrictions. Dirt and cottonwood fluff clog condenser fins. Airflow declines, head stress climbs, and the compressor cooks. We have seen all new units fail within 3 seasons since no person washed the coil.

Refrigerant concerns. Reduced fee from a leakage, overcharge from a well suggesting yet rushed tech, or contamination from a careless fixing can all drive a compressor out of its risk-free operating envelope. R‑22 legacy systems are especially in danger since lots of have actually been topped off repeatedly. When the oil is acidified, failing refers time.

Poor setup. A system can look neat and still be wrong. Discharge lines without proper oil return incline, line establishes too tiny for the tonnage, or a vacuum that never reached a true 500 microns, all shorten compressor life.

A field tale that discusses the math

Last July, we took a heating and cooling repair service call from a family in Maryvale with a 12 years of age 4 ton rooftop heatpump. No air conditioning, 109 outdoors, interior temperature level 88 and climbing. Fixed pressure looked reasonable, coil clean, blower solid. Stress were high, subcooling unpredictable. The compressor was drawing locked blades amps on start, then tripping. We validated capacitor worths, checked the contactor, and checked voltage under load. The compressor insulation tested to ground at borderline values. The producer's service warranty had actually ended. The quote for a compressor change, including crane, healing, and a brand-new filter drier with a correct evacuation, came to simply under 4,200 dollars. The quote for a full rooftop replacement with a mid rate two stage model, aesthetic adapter, and authorization was 12,600.

They asked the right inquiry. Will I be back right here paying again if something else goes? We walked them through the remaining life of the blower electric motor, the board, the reversing shutoff that was starting to stick, and the cupboard insulation that had actually crumbled. They chose the complete replacement, partly for energy financial savings, partly to stop wagering every summertime weekend break. Their APS bills stopped by about 15 percent, which follows going from a tired 10 SEER matching to a brand-new SEER2 14.3 package in a well sealed home.

How we determine: fix the compressor or change the unit

There is no solitary guideline that fits each home. We attempt to give house owners the same structure we would utilize on our own place.

  • Cost motorists that favor compressor replacement:

  • Unit is under parts service warranty, and labor is manageable.

  • The remainder of the system remains in good condition, with documented maintenance.

  • The performance and convenience of the present system currently satisfy your needs.

  • Cost drivers that prefer complete device substitute:

  • The system is 10 to 15 years of ages, particularly roof plans with UV wear.

  • Multiple major components reveal aging, such as coil leakages and control board corrosion.

  • You desire lower bills and a quieter system, not just a band aid.

We also check out the refrigerant. If you get on an R‑22 system, even an effective compressor swap leaves you with a refrigerant that is expensive and reducing in schedule. If the interior coil is R‑22 only and the exterior unit is R‑410A or R‑454B capable, compatibility becomes an issue. In those cases, putting lots of money into a compressor is frequently throwing great money after bad.

The various other pricey parts you ought to know

The compressor gets the headings, however a few various other parts have high cost in Phoenix.

The evaporator coil. Inside the air trainer or furnace cabinet, this coil can leak from formicary corrosion or physical damage. Replacing it is labor heavy. A coil change on a split system usually lands between 1,400 and 3,200 bucks set up, relying on gain access to and cooling agent. In messy attic rooms, the coil's insulation and drainpipe pans can likewise need focus, adding to cost.

The condenser coil. On several modern devices, the coil twists around the cabinet in a solitary serpentine. If an area is crushed by windblown debris or a pressure washer splits fins, repair might not be possible. A new coil can cost as long as a third to half the rate of a complete condenser. That truth presses several house owners toward replacing the whole outside unit, not just the coil.

Variable rate blower motors and control panel. ECM electric motors and exclusive boards that talk to inverter compressors bring higher parts costs. A variable speed indoor electric motor installed can run 900 to 1,800 bucks. An interacting control board, if lightning or a rise takes it out, can be similar. While not as costly as a compressor, they are not tiny tickets.

Ductwork and plenums. In Phoenix az attic rooms, ducts bake. Seams fall short, insulation slides, and air flow suffers. Changing a couple of runs or rebuilding a plenum to cure hot areas is not a solitary part price, however it shows up on the exact same billing. In actual terms, air flow solutions add 800 to 3,000 dollars to numerous larger substitutes, and they are usually the distinction between a system that fulfills its SEER theoretically and one that delivers convenience at 4 p.m.

What we look for during a compressor diagnosis

A truthful heating and cooling firm ought to invest more time diagnosing than marketing. We document the electrical side initially. That indicates start and run capacitors under tons, contactor condition, cable temperature, and voltage sag at beginning. We transfer to refrigerant information with superheat and subcooling, then compare those to target worths for the devices. Temperature level split across the coil informs us the indoor side tale. Amp make use of the compressor against nameplate worths is another check. When we suspect acid in the oil, we evaluate it. If we locate contamination, we clarify the steps required, including filter driers and a detailed emptying with a micron scale. We take images. We show you the megohm reading to ground. A compressor quote without this degree of information is a hunch, and guesses often tend to cost more later.

Warning indications home owners see before a major bill

  • Longer run times to reach the same thermostat setpoint, particularly in the late afternoon.
  • Lights dimming when the AC starts, and the outdoor unit appearing rough or straining.
  • Warm air throughout the defrost cycle on a heatpump lasting longer than it utilized to, or constant brief cycling.
  • Spiking power expenses in June and July compared to previous summertimes without modification in usage.
  • Humming exterior system with a stumbled breaker, or a breaker that journeys more than once.

Efficiency selections that affect long-term costs

The most inexpensive repair is not constantly the lowest cost over 5 years. In Phoenix metro, equipment that can pull down interior temps throughout top heat without running all out for hours has value. Two stage compressors use an excellent middle ground. They take care of the majority of the day in reduced phase, then move right into high when the attic and west encountering wall surfaces are radiating heat. Inverter systems take that additionally, modulating to match lots and commonly holding tighter humidity control.

We see real differences comfortably. A 16 SEER2 2 stage unit, effectively sized with tidy air ducts, usually cuts peak electrical energy by 15 to 25 percent versus a 12 to 13 SEER2 single stage it replaces. An inverter can conserve even more and run quieter, however it brings higher part and repair service prices. If you intend to stay in the home for 7 or more years, and you have certified a/c solutions to maintain it, the financial investment can make sense. If you are flipping a rental or you relocate typically, a strong solitary phase or more stage might be smarter.

Heat pump or gas heater pairing for Phoenix metro homes

Heat pumps have actually won a great deal of ground in the Valley. Winters are moderate, so a heatpump deals with most home heating days without electric strip warmth. If your home has gas service, a twin gas system sets a heat pump with a gas heater for colder evenings and strong warm at low operating expense. The option influences what stops working and what costs money later on. Heat pumps add a reversing valve, thaw board, and much more compressor hours annually. A gas furnace adds a heat exchanger and burning controls. We look at your prices with APS or SRP, your ductwork, and your roof covering space before suggesting a path. Both can be trustworthy when mounted right.

Permits, code, and the roofing system reality

City and county licenses are not window clothing. They shield you when you sell, and they keep installments lined up with safety policies. On roofs, clearances around gas lines, condensate directing, and hail storm guards on coils issue. We see a lot of systems jammed against parapet walls that recirculate their very own hot air. That blunder costs you every July in higher head stress and reduced capacity. A good a/c firm Phoenix metro vast will certainly reveal you the code clearances and clarify the airflow course in plain terms. It is not attractive, yet it is the distinction in between a compressor going for 210 degrees discharge temperature level and one humming along at 180.

Maintenance that in fact expands compressor life

Skip the fluff. The products that settle in our environment are easy. Keep condenser coils clean. We rinse from the inside out with reduced pressure water and a coil risk-free cleaner, not a stress washer that folds fins. Replace air filters in a timely manner to secure the evaporator coil and keep fixed stress in range. Check capacitors every springtime under tons, not just with a bench meter. Confirm cooling agent fee by superheat and subcooling, not by guesswork. Log numbers year over year, because patterns disclose concerns that a person check out can not. If you are on an inverter system, maintain the control board compartments clean and secured. Dust eliminates electronics slowly.

Warranties, discounts, and timing the work

Most major brands carry a ten years parts guarantee when signed up. Labor is often 1 to 3 years unless you get a prolonged plan. If your compressor falls short inside the parts home window, your largest cost becomes labor, refrigerant, and incidentals. That can turn a 4,500 buck work right into a 1,600 to 2,500 dollar work. Maintain your documents and serial numbers handy. We also inspect APS and SRP programs. Refunds alter, but high effectiveness replacements and wise thermostats typically receive modest credit ratings that counter component of the project.

Timing matters. The exact same roof crane that sets you back 600 dollars in October can cost 1,200 in July when booked on short notification. If your system is limping along in April, do yourself a favor and timetable job prior to the first 105 level stretch. You will have extra options and less downtime.

A brief expense fact check for Phoenix metro homeowners

A compressor substitute on a ground placed split system: frequently 2,800 to 5,000 bucks installed.

A compressor replacement on a rooftop package with crane and proper discharge: typically 4,000 to 7,500 dollars installed.

A full outside device swap for a split system, maintaining the indoor coil if compatible and tidy: typically 5,500 to 10,500 bucks, with effectiveness, brand name, and line set length affecting price.

A full packaged rooftop substitute with visual job: typically 9,000 to 18,000 dollars.

An interior evaporator coil substitute: commonly 1,400 to 3,200 dollars.

These are real world ranges we see throughout our a/c services. Your home's specifics can swing numbers up or down, however the relative order rarely transforms. The compressor is the heavyweight, and roof logistics can turn the whole unit into the cost champion.

Choosing the right course for your home

If your air conditioning is under 8 years of ages, has actually been maintained, and fails its compressor, a repair typically makes sense, specifically with a legitimate components warranty. Between 8 and 12 years, the response relies on condition, energy goals, and any kind of indications of cascading failings. Past 12 years, particularly on rooftops, many owners are much better offered by substitute. Every situation deserves a mindful appearance. We have actually conserved plenty of compressors that would have condemned, and we have replaced a lot of rooftop plans that got on their third significant fixing in five summers.
